DP-ICM Artillery Abbreviation

DP-ICM has various meanings in the Artillery category. Discover the full forms, definitions, and usage contexts of DP-ICM in Artillery.

Dual Purpose Improved Conventional Munition
Artillery

Citation

Last updated: